Ingredients

3 medium carrots
4 garlic cloves , minced
2 tablespoons fresh parsley
1 cup red wine vinegar
1/4 teaspoon salt ( to your taste )
1 cup black olives ( optional )
Carrots in Vinegar (Cenouras Em Conserva) is a traditional Brazilian recipe that is popular as an appetizer. This dish is perfect for those who love the taste of vinegar and are looking for a healthy and tasty snack or side dish. The carrots are marinated in a mixture of red wine vinegar, garlic, and fresh parsley to give them a tangy and flavorful taste. This recipe is easy to make and can be stored in the fridge for up to a month, making it a great option for meal prep. The addition of black olives is optional, but they add a nice briny flavor and a pop of color to the dish.

Instructions

1.Start by cleaning and cutting the carrots into thin sticks.
2.In a jar, add the minced garlic and fresh parsley.
3.Pour in the red wine vinegar and add salt to taste.
4.Add the carrot sticks and black olives (if using) to the jar.
5.Close the jar and shake well to mix everything together.
6.Place the jar in the fridge and let it marinate for at least 24 hours.
7.Serve chilled and enjoy!
